Frankly if the spec is getting bored with your ACR you're doing too many phases. There's a vocal minority of respected magicians ranging from Derren Brown to Mark Lewis who assert that displaying skill with cards is no bad thing. On the other hand the whole Dynamo mid trick flourishing thing is grating to watch and probably highly mis-timed, after all you don't want to remind an audience how great you are at controlling the deck immediately after they've put their card back into it.
